The Weapons Though from first glance, the weapons in UT3 may look similar to their UT2K4 counterparts, they have been retooled and modified for a more competitive feel. My favorite, the Shock Rifle, has had both it's primary and secondary firing modes to accommodate the faster gameplay that comes with the game as a whole. Most notably, its second fire (an explodable ball of energy) is faster, and when shot, is noticeably more powerful than before, almost to an unfair amount. Other modifications include faster rockets, an improved secondary fire for the Link Gun and the ever-important fast single shot from the Bio Rifle. I think with a little more work and input from the community, the weapons system could be made a little bit more even before the game fully releases. Competitive Factor At first glance, this game has the makings to become a very successful FPS in multiple realms of competitive play. First off, the UT series is still know as one of THE most exciting games for TDM, and this version seems no different. Epic stuck with what made this game so popular among TDM fans and only made it better. With the exception of the "DarkWalker" I really enjoyed TDM against the bots, and I can honestly say I'd give it a try online with a team when more servers become available. As I have yet to play duel against anyone, I know one thing; THERE SURE AS HELL BETTER NOT BE ANY VEHICLES OR DAMAGE AMP IN DUEL MODE when the game releases. I don't want to be up by three frags on someone, only to turn a corner to see Mr.DarkWalker staring at me and blast the hell out of me for the rest of the match. Also, Developers, be smart when you're designing duel maps. Generally, this game is pretty slow for a duel game; don't make duel maps that will allow one player to hide from the other for the rest of the match if they are up by a few frags. Overall though, it'll be interesting to see how the dueling community reacts to the game when duel maps are released at launch.
